Interest from Milan continues to linger for Katsouranis
When reports initially broke out about a move to AC Milan for Benfica’s Kostas Katsouranis, it seemed to be a joke. Now, a week after reports revealed Carlo Ancelotti was interested in recruiting the Greece international, it seems there is a possibility Katsouranis could be on his way to the San Siro.
The ‘Rossoneri’, have been devastated by the loss of Gennaro Gattuso and it appears Katsouranis is an ideal replacement for the Italy international. Not a typical club to be associated with one of Greece’s finest, Milan would be a stellar club for the former AEK Athens star.
Katsouranis had asked to leave the Lisbon club in the summer, after an on-field altercation with club captain Luisao left the Greek star on edge within the Benfica ranks. Interest continued to come from Katsouranis’ former Greek Super League employers AEK Athens, but Katsouranis acknowledged a move to Panathinaikos in the future was a possibility, but never to archrivals Olympiacos.
Though AEK was an immediate possibility in the summer, the price tag was far too high for AEK to have a Katsouranis return.
With Katsouranis acknowledging Milan’s interest, it seems the Greece international could be the first of his kind to play for the ‘Rossoneri’. While Milan might be willing to pay up for one of Greece’s most crucial contributors, the only obstacle in reaching a deal maybe Katsouranis’ current employers, who in the past have proven to be tough negotiators over the rights to the Greek midfielder.
